Committed to Martial Arts

The people who are committed to martial arts belong to the martial arts community. This group of individuals has one strong goal in mind. This goal is to provide the resources needed to others who are just as serious about learning and enjoying martial arts. The community may be a local group, a larger entity and even a global martial arts community. The people of the community provide a network of information that others can use to learn what is important to them. Finding ways to improve your techniques, tips, friends, and opportunities are just a few of the major benefits that belonging to a martial arts community can provide.

The martial arts community is just one resource that those interested in participating in the sport can take advantage of. A martial arts guide is another way to learn more about the sport you may be interested in. Although many different varieties exist, most people enjoy the fellowship of others who participate in the sport. When you are part of the martial arts community, you have access to people from all types of backgrounds and cultural values. Diversity is a great way to learn more about other societies and to help foster understanding among people of different cultures. By having something in common, a foundation is created that each person can build upon.

Make sure you understand everything you can about the type of martial arts you are interested in before you make a decision to commit to that type. If you make a poorly informed decision, it could affect whether or not you will not only be successful but whether you will actually stick with the program. Information is critical to ensuring the right choice is made. If you are trying to gather information for someone else, you should be sure you understand what that person is looking for concerning the sport.

Anyone can make a good choice if he or she makes sure he or she knows everything he or she can in advance. Even if you have made a choice and are just beginning to learn a form of martial arts, you should pay attention so you can adjust your plan if things are not going the way you thought it would. It is never too late to change your mind as long as you make the change for the right reason and not because you just want to quit. Committing to martial arts is necessary if you wish to become part of the community of people who already understand the sport.

Do not forget to learn about the philosophies that compliment many of the different types of martial arts. You might enjoy doing certain types of martial arts but find the philosophy behind the sport to be not to your liking. The philosophy is just as important as the physical aspects of the sport. Personal development is essential to being able to make a lasting commitment to whichever type of martial arts you choose to try and eventually, enjoy.
